Store Your Lingerie With Care

Posted on: 18 February 2020

Delicate bras and panties should never be stuffed inside of a drawer, at least if you want them to last. When you cram all your lingerie into one space, a bra hook can snag the lace on a pair of your underwear, you might lose the conversion strap for your strapless bra — the list goes on.
